Cost of Living in Mohler
Understanding the cost of living in Mohler is essential for prospective residents. Compared to the national average, many expenses in Mohler are quite reasonable.
Housing Comparison
- Renting: Rent prices are below the national average, making it more affordable for individuals and families.
- Buying: Home values are also lower, providing good opportunities for home ownership.
Utilities and Services
- Utility Costs: Monthly utility bills in Mohler tend to be lower than average, especially in terms of electricity.
- Internet and Cable: Prices vary depending on service providers, but options are available for different budgets.
Food and Groceries
- Grocery Costs: Prices for groceries are on par with the national average, but shopping locally can save money.
- Dining Out: Eating out is generally affordable, with a range of options from casual to more upscale dining.
